Abstract


This chapter discussed the evaluation methodology of the Fog-ROCL strategy. The strategy is evaluated using the different scenarios. Results showed that the Fog-ROCL strategy is more efficient than other strategies. However, the dynamic nature of traffic has a dynamic impact of the fixed RSU setup. It is concluded that a fixed RSU setup cannot cope with the dynamic traffic. Moreover, results revealed that scenarios with high obstacle-density becomes harder to solve using the multi-objective version of the Fog-ROCL strategy.
